钷 (pǒ) refers to the chemical element promethium, which is a rare earth metal and part of the lanthanide series. In common usage, it is primarily encountered in scientific contexts, particularly in chemistry and physics, where it is discussed in relation to its properties and applications.

Usage Notes

Be mindful that 钷 is a technical term and is rarely used in everyday conversations. It is primarily used in formal scientific discussions or texts. Ensure correct pronunciation with the third tone, as mispronouncing it could lead to confusion with other similar-sounding words.

Common Mistakes

Learners often confuse 钷 with other similar characters like 铽 (tè), which refers to a different element. Always check the context to ensure you are using the correct term for promethium.
